Mao and the Cultural Revolution Paper China in the Cultural Revolution The historically unprecedented great peoples proletarian cultural revolution was a struggle for supremacy within the Chinese communist party which manifested into a wide scale social and political upheaval which brought china in 1966 to the brink of all out civil war. Although millions of people were murdered and tortured during its bloody course the cultural revolution is a chapter of china’s history rarely talked about, its just bad business to bring it up with someone who’s buying 26 percent of the world’s oil and 42% of all concrete produced globally. The Cultural Revolution was a period of vast upheaval and organized vandalism the likes of which had never occurred before, and through historical analysis it is reasonable to conclude that the great Cultural Revolution of 1966-67 was merely a means for Mao Zedong to purge the Chinese Communist Party and consolidate his own personal power. A period of calm and stable economic conservatism had settled over china after the upheaval and fervor of the great leap forward, and with its spectacular failure the moderates inside the CCP gained more power as Mao and his fiercely socialist policies lost considerable support. In this environment of political moderation and conservatism the ailing Mao felt capitalist and elitist ideology was infiltrating the party and the main goals of the 1949 revolution were being abandoned, and that to ensure the future of the communist party and china as a socialist state a reinvigoration of revolutionary spirit among the youths and children of china was necessary. It was from this small struggle to regain control over the party apparatus that a great public movement among students and the urban youth took hold all throughout china, and its destructive effects touched the lives of almost every Chinese person, from its epicenter in Beijing to the furthest provinces in Xiamen. For a little while, Mao disappeared from the centre of Chinese politics, and after his resignation as party secretary he retreated to his own devices to plan his next move against his growing enemies Deng Xiaoping and Zhou Enlai. Coinciding with this move was a great call to all workers and students to rededicate themselves to unwavering class struggle and eliminate bourgeoisie and upper class thinking and ideals and focus on promoting the virtues of the agrarian proletariat. This opportunity to escape work and indulge in blind ideological hysteria proved very tempting for most Chinese students and by the 16th of October millions of Red Guards, as they were dubbed, flocked to mass rallies in Tiananmen Square, where Mao and Lin Biao made frequent appearances to over 11 million adoring youths. With this call to arms throughout all major institutions Mao enlisted the impressionable and easily led youth of china as his instrument for reimposing his will upon the nation and reshaping it. The revolutionary fervor and blind fanaticism of the red guards was matched by no other in Chinese society, and indoctrinated teenagers all over china rushed to do his bidding and destroy the 4 Olds, the 4 enemies of the continuing revolution as outlined by Mao, old culture, old thoughts, old customs and old habits. In a practical sense Mao had ordained the destruction of religious sites and relics as well as the torture and imprisonment of anyone seen to be an â€Å"enemy of the revolution†. It was in this way that the Cultural Revolution broadened from an internal communist party purge to a mass public movement in line with the self preserving aims of Mao. Giant posters in universities and schools encouraged students to join the struggle against all those who had diverted from the revolutionary path, and in July in a carefully orchestrated propaganda event Mao was seen swimming in the Yangtze River, a move which served to rally further support for the revolution. This specific event touched the hearts of many Chinese and led to serious momentum behind the revolution, in modern terms it is the equivalent of Queen Elizabeth swimming the English channel, and it is easy to see why this great symbolic gesture excited all of china and inspired loyalty and devotion among the Chinese for their appearingly strong and wise leader. Mao took the opportunity of revolution to finally dispose of his political enemies, and it was his newly formed and wildly devoted red guards he used to publicly ridicule and intimidate his opponents both in Beijing and the outer provinces. After a rally held specifically against them and their actions, Mao’s two main rivals Deng Xiaoping and Lui Shaoqui were both purged, Lui beaten and imprisoned in foul conditions until his death in 1973, and Deng sent to corrective labor in Jiangxi province after witnessing the crippling of his son Pufang at the hands of the Red guards. As the existing student movement was elevated to a mass national campaign, attacks on religious and historical institutions intensified and many churches and temples were looted and destroyed. From the centers of the movement, the universities and schools, red guards took control of towns and cities and were allowed free reign by the police and government to hold ‘great debates’ and rallies and persecute all those with which they didn’t agree. At this time Red guards were also encouraged to travel to Beijing with free transport and food provided by the government and many took the opportunity to make a pilgrimage to Tiananmen Square to catch a glimpse of their beloved leader. By the end of 1966 Mao had a giant, easily manipulated, blindly devoted and violent army with which he consolidated his rule over the communist party with an iron fist, and at the same time elevated his personal following to almost cult status. In 1967 china Mao’s word was law, and involvement in some sort of revolutionary activity was the only way to avoid being purged. When analyzing this period of Chinese history many agree that the Cultural Revolution was carefully orchestrated by Mao Zedong himself and that the Red Guard movement grew out of prepared soil. Alongside great cruelty and egotistic mania Mao showed an astute grasp of mass psychology, he knew that the students were the most suggestible and easily manipulated group in Chinese society, and he appealed directly to them to create a vast political instrument with which he could forcefully impose his will upon the whole of china. The Cultural Revolution began to finally wind down in 1969, although many historians argue that it didn’t finally end until the arrest and subsequent execution of the â€Å"Gang of Four† in 1979. The effects of the Cultural Revolution directly or indirectly touched every facet of Chinese society, and the 10 years of organized vandalism and civil unrest brought the education system and economy to a grinding halt. Perhaps never before in human history has a political leader unleashed such massive forces against the system that he created, and it was the Cultural Revolution’s aim to ultimately alter the ideological nature and soul of the people which made its effects so chilling. From mid-1973 until Maos death in September 1976, Chinese politics shifted back and forth between Jiang Qing and those who supported her (notably Wang Hongwen, Zhang Chunqiao, and Yao Wenyuan, who with Jiang Qing were later dubbed the Gang of Four,) and the Zhou-Deng group. The former favored ideology, political mobilization, class struggle, anti intellectualism, egalitarianism, and xenophobia, while the latter promoted economic growth, stability, educational progress, and a pragmatic foreign policy. In recent years china has taken steps to rehabilitate the millions of Chinese displaced and formally recognized the full extent of the damage caused by the Cultural Revolution, although any expressions tracing blame back to the CCP are fiercely censored. By conducting unbiased historical analysis and with the benefit of hindsight it is reasonable to conclude that the cultural revolution was nothing more than a vast political and ideological purge which was aimed at eliminating every semblance of tradition, decency and intellectualism, in due course leaving only the divine chairman Mao and a clean slate upon which for him to propound his ideology and political agenda. The Red Guards were not only officially sanctioned but directed by the government, as police were ordered not to interfere in red guard activities and even give them information on ‘class enemies’. As John K Fairbank observed, â€Å"The idealistic youngsters who appeared to lead the Cultural Revolution were in fact nothing more than pawns in the power struggle within the CCP†. Generally, the construction industry in the United States is among the largest industries, the largest employer, and the most hazardous industries, which contrib ute to approximately 20% of the annual occupational fatalities reported across the United States (Brunette, 2004). The Latino community is one of the immigrant communities in the United States that provide essential labor to the construction industry but often considered vulnerable to injuries and fatalities than other ethnicities. A body of evidence indicates that Latino men, who work in the construction industry, continue to experience higher rates of occupational injuries and related fatalities than other workers do in the United States. In a specific contemporary study, Roelofs et al. (2011) undertook a qualitative investigation about the perspectives of Hispanic workers in the construction industry regarding factors influencing occupational hazards and safety. Consecutively, using two focus group interviews with Hispanic construction workers, Roelofs et al. . (2011) reveal that Hispanic workers usually have higher risks of occupational injuries than other ethnicities, as 3.7, 3.4, and 3.0 are incidents of injuries per 100,000 workers among the Hispanics, the Whites, and the Blacks respectively. Moreover, according to Brunette (2014), the Hispanics generally constitute the highest population of the workforce in the construction, which is estimated at 18% of workforce with evidence indicating that Hispanic constructors are steadily rising disproportionately when compared to other ethnicities in the construction industry. Similar investigations have persisted in several studies to justify the claims of vulnerability of Hispanic construction workers to injuries and fatalities. By using the national census surveillance system to determine workforce fatalities, Richardson et al. According to Roelofs et al. (2011), several interrelated factors contribute to a predisposition of Hispanic construction workers to injuries and fatalities in the construction industry. As the immigrant community in the United States, Hispanics are among the marginalized communities. Researchers have established numerous factors that predispose the Latino male constructors to occupational injuries and accidents. Roelofs et al. (2011) postulate that â€Å"language barriers, cultural differences, lac k of safety training, economic disadvantage, lack of construction experience, and relegated to the most dangerous jobs within construction are major predisposing factors† (p. 1). Concerning language barrier as a predisposing factor to occupational injuries and fatalities, Latino men akin to other immigrant communities have little linguistic skills in the use of English (Ochsner et al., 2012). Due to their inability to communicate fluently in English and master safety workplace precautions, their chances of incurring injuries remain relatively high. Menzel and Gutierrez (2010) confirm such notions in an investigation of 30 Latino constructors. Even though companies sometimes provide employees with safety training and some required materials, the translation of language is ordinarily poor and thus Latino constructors hardly comprehend instructions (Menzel Gutierrez, 2010). Out of the 30 participants, seven mentioned that they felt ashamed of their accent. Culturally, Latino wor kers are very industrious, an attribute that make employers in the construction industry to target them. The notion that Latino workers value and embrace hard work puts them in an intolerable environment in the construction industry that is prone to accidents (Ochsner et al., 2012). Traditional values of Latinos embrace hard work and thus predispose Latinos to hazardous work, which is the economic activity of supporting their families. Apart from language barriers and cultural differences, construction industries have little concern for the welfare of the Latino constructors. According to Brunette (2004), low education and lack of appropriate and effective safety training are significant issues that dispose Latino male constructors to occupational injuries and fatalities. Socioeconomic inequalities are among the significant factors that force the Latino male constructors to engage in risky undertakings solely to provide for their families (Richardson et al., 2004). Competence and sk ills determine the effectiveness and alertness of workers in the construction industry. Since Latino workers lack expertise in the construction industry, their chances of causing accidents are relatively high. Latino men rarely hold top management positions in the construction industry and therefore compel them to perform menial jobs, which are not only hazardous but also unproductive. The Function and Role of Research for the Health and Social Care Sector Essay The term research is defined as an active, thorough and systematic process of enquiry that is aimed at discovering, interpreting and revising facts. It is defined by Lancaster (1975) as â€Å"a planned, systematic search for information, for the purpose of increasing the total of man’s knowledge†. It is described by Polit and Beck (2004) as being systematic enquiry. They write that â€Å"the ultimate goal of research is to develop, refine and expand a body of knowledge†. The importance of carrying out research is to further knowledge, enhance understanding and to assess effectiveness. The word research itself derives from the French language and when translated literally means â€Å"to investigate thoroughly†. In the Health and Social Care sector research is important. It has various purposes, roles and value within Health and Social Care. As today’s society is an information-driven one nearly all decisions made regarding policies and practices require deliberation and evaluation of the evidence base. This basically means that health and social care professionals are no longer able to rely solely on just theoretical knowledge. This is where research comes into practice. In social care today organisations are expected to be research-minded. This means that research must be carried out, which can be done in a variety of forms. In the Health and Social Care sector research has many purposes. The main purposes of research are to confirm policy, confirm practice, to disprove propositions, to extend knowledge and understanding and to improve practice. All service providers need information about the needs of a community, or group of people before it can be decided what resources and services are required to meet this need. Therefore research is required. By carrying out research in health and social care practice can be improved and knowledge extended. Once research is published and is made available to health and social care practitioners the findings can be used to improve services in such a way that service providers are able to carry out their duties more profoundly. For example, research regarding the spread of MRSA led to initiatives being put in place to change practice. In the example of public health implementations, research is very important. In health and social care settings research can also be used to monitor progress. This is a vital role of research. If a health care initiative was put in place e. g. ante-natal care, research allows service providers to perceive its uptake, and based on this research may allow for initiatives to be put in place to increase participation. Without monitoring there is no way of knowing if an initiative is useful to service users or not.

Introduction Women’s rights and societal roles have varied throughout history. Yet, a common theme that is notable across many times and cultures is the notion that women are inferior to men. In ancient Greece, the opinion toward women followed this trend, and women were often overlooked in how they could contribute to society. It was rarely considered that the traits women share could be of use beyond their household duties. In this essay I will analyze the Platonic and Aristotelian views on the role and status of women. Although Plato and Aristotle had distinct beliefs on what women could contribute to the collective well being of society, they shared similar opinions about the genuine status that women had in comparison to men. The Platonic view advanced the idea that secluding women to the home was counter-productive to the community as a whole. As such, women should be afforded roles that stretched beyond the boundaries of the home for the benefit of the community. The Aristotelian v iew, contrastingly, believed that the natural characteristics of women, which deemed them physically and intellectually inferior to men, made the home their proper place within society. In this essay I will advance the view that through the logic constructed by both Plato and Aristotle it follows deductively that women not only have a place outside of the home but their distinctive nature can add something of value to many areas of society. A Platonic View Toward Women: A Community of Women and Children It is sometimes contended that Plato was a feminist, but his concern for women did not stem from an interest in women’s rights, but rather the usefulness women could contribute to the benefit of the community.
